Start your trip by immersing yourself in the spiritual atmosphere of Ujjain, a city known for its ancient temples and religious significance. In the morning, visit the Mahakaleshwar Temple, one of the twelve Jyotirlingas dedicated to Lord Shiva. Witness the morning aarti (prayer ceremony) and experience the divine ambience.
In the afternoon, head to the Kal Bhairav Temple, dedicated to Lord Bhairav, a fierce form of Lord Shiva. Take a walk in the serene Ram Ghat area along the banks of the Shipra River. Enjoy a boat ride and soak in the peaceful surroundings.
In the evening, explore the bustling streets of the Chhatri Chowk area, known for its colorful markets and street food. Indulge in local delicacies like poha jalebi and kachori. End your day with a visit to the Harsiddhi Temple, believed to fulfill wishes.
Embark on a journey to explore the historical and cultural heritage of Ujjain. Begin your day by visiting the Kaliadeh Palace, situated on an island in the Shipra River. Marvel at the architectural beauty of this palace and enjoy the panoramic views.
In the afternoon, head to the Ujjain Observatory, also known as Vedh Shala. It is one of the five observatories built by Maharaja Jai Singh II and houses ancient astronomical instruments. Learn about the scientific knowledge of ancient India.
In the evening, visit the Bhartrihari Caves, situated on the banks of the Shipra River. These caves are associated with the famous poet-saint Bhartrihari and offer a serene and tranquil atmosphere.

While exploring Ujjain, don't miss out on the hidden gems and local favorites. Visit the Sandipani Ashram, a spiritual and educational center, where Lord Krishna is believed to have received his education. It offers a tranquil environment and promotes Vedic studies.
Another off the beaten path attraction is the Mangalnath Temple, situated at the birthplace of Mars according to Hindu mythology. It offers panoramic views of the city and is a popular spot for stargazing.
